# Contacts: Soft Deletes in the `orders` Table

When a customer reports a missing order, it has usually been soft-deleted rather than removed; the record still exists with a deletion timestamp. Support staff should never request a manual restore from engineering directly. Instead, file a restore request with the Marloft data-operations group at the address below.

pager mailbox: silael.sorwyn.tamius@zemvarsys.corp

## Ownership: Cron Migration to Wavelattice

Legacy cron jobs on the Thornapple batch hosts are being migrated to the Wavelattice workflow engine in stages. During migration, some jobs exist in both systems; the Wavelattice copy is authoritative once its dashboard shows it enabled. Support team: if a customer reports a missed or duplicated job run, check the migration tracker sheet first, and do not manually re-trigger legacy crons. Escalations for any migration-related incident go to the single accountable owner listed below.

account owner for kafop-haweg: Pelax Gilael Istir

Handover — image cache leak, Vexley thumbnail service.

Leak is in the eviction path: entries pinned by the preview worker never release after timeout. Heap grows ~300MB/day. Mitigation: nightly restart cron, already in place. Proper fix half-done on the feature branch; needs the pin refcount rework finished. Don't ship without soak testing 48h. Diagnostics mode on the cache node requires unlocking with the recovery passphrase below.

vault phrase of tajef-tafog = istox-sorax-zorox-casok-holox-kelix-weneth-drueth-casion

**Ticket: Log sampling drift on Murkfen ingest**

Murkfen's sampling config has drifted from the baseline again. Three nodes are logging at full volume; storage alerts fired twice this week. Likely cause: manual edits during last month's incident never reverted. Do not hand-edit — redeploy from the template. Support: if customers report missing log lines, this is why. Canonical sampling settings follow.

settings of fafog-haduf:
ZORIX_PIN=4648
ZORIX_METRICS_HOST=metrics.zorix.paliqsys.corp
ZORIX_LOG_LEVEL=info
ZORIX_TENANT=druix